Biochem/physiol Actions RETRA is a mutant p53-dependent activator of p73, an activator of p53-regulated genes, and a suppressor of mutant p53-bearing tumor cells. Greater than 50% of tumors express mutant p53 which is defective for the tumor-suppressor function and contributes to malignancy by blocking a p53 family member p73. Activation of p73 in human cancer produces a cytotoxic effect. RETRA increases expression level of p73 and releases p73 from the inhibitory complex with mutant 53. It thereby produces tumor-supressor effect, in vitro and in vivo, similar to functional reactivation of p53. |
